Transaction 57695e822459c86ac9076fc580611459c993a8a8967344a5857e4be9f5ceac4a

1 Input
2 Outputs
  • 57695e822459c86ac9076fc580611459c993a8a8967344a5857e4be9f5ceac4a:0
  • value  1110776
    address  3CT4sdsaGH7U9SovNNzo7BCbwTcXiQRKgN
  • 57695e822459c86ac9076fc580611459c993a8a8967344a5857e4be9f5ceac4a:1
  • value  1416949
    address  1BuHhus1CmNLtE6gdg9Lwr7PLqXKrJK8Ln